Nicosia arrest after police open fire on car

Date:

On Wednesday night a 23-year-old man was the subject of a Nicosia arrest following a dramatic police intervention involving warning shots.

According to initial reports, officers from the Z-unit patrol attempted to stop a vehicle that was being driven aggressively and without licence plates. When the driver allegedly tried to attack them, police responded by firing at the car’s tyres to immobilise it.

The suspect was quickly arrested. During a search of the vehicle, police discovered 17 grams of cannabis, 13 grams of methamphetamine, and 6 grams of cocaine.

The Nicosia arrest has raised questions over how far police are willing to go to neutralise potentially dangerous suspects. No injuries were reported, and investigations are still underway.

Authorities say the Nicosia arrest highlights their ongoing efforts to crack down on drug-related crime and violence against officers.
